Because crew-served weapons like the M2 Browning, the MG42, or the M60 draw immediate enemy attention, the machine gunner is frequently portrayed as the tactical anchor of a squad—and consequently, a prime target. In serious war dramas like Saving Private Ryan or Band of Brothers , the machine gunner’s story arc often revolves around the immense burden of sustaining high-volume suppressive fire while knowing they are the enemy's number one priority.
